The wintertime treatment will certainly differ depending on where you are expanding 'Knock senseless' roses. Include a two-to-three-inch layer of organic compost when expanding in the ground. Usage leaves, ache, or straw to protect the plant's roots and assist protect it throughout the winter season. Adding a burlap covering around the plant can additionally assist shield the plant from extreme weather.

One more usual issue is leaves populated with tiny openings. The perpetrator is a sawfly that lays tiny eggs on the bottoms of the fallen leaves. The eggs hatch into larvae called increased slugs that eat away at the leaves from the undersides, leaving little "windows" and holes.

Rose conditions, such as fine-grained mildew, corrosion, and sometimes black spot, can influence these roses. Still, increased rosette is a virus that spreads out from the eriophyid mite and can trigger contorted stems and leaves. 'Knock Out' roses are susceptible to this virus, and the finest method to treat it is by digging up the plant and getting rid of the unhealthy areas.

The ideal time to cut down shrub roses, including the preferred "Knock-Out" collection, is when they are simply starting to sprout new growth. The new shoots in springtime will certainly inform you where the plant is toughest. It's crucial to be person; if you cut roses as well quickly, or in the fall, they will certainly pass away back from your cuts and need rehabilitative trimming later on.

They can endure and grow in completely dry climates, yet they prefer moist soil Homepage with excellent water drainage. These roses flourish in soil with a p, H of 6. 0 to 6. 5. Check your soil with a home set. If the p, H degree is too expensive, include sulfur or pine needles to the dirt.

Ko roses can be planted essentially throughout the year. It's ideal to stay clear of planting in severe weather problems, consisting of wintertime and the warm summer months.
